HJ 634-2012 Soil.Determination of ammonium, nitrite and nitrate by extraction with potassium chloride solution-spectrophotometric methods (English Version)
This standard specifies the potassium chloride solution extraction-spectrophotometric method for the determination of ammonia nitrogen, nitrite nitrogen, and nitrate nitrogen in soil. This standard is applicable to the determination of ammonia nitrogen, nitrite nitrogen, and nitrate nitrogen in soil. When the sample amount is 40.0 g, the detection limits of this method for determining ammonia nitrogen, nitrite nitrogen, and nitrate nitrogen in soil are 0.10 mg/kg, 0.15 mg/kg, and 0.25 mg/kg respectively, and the lower detection limits are 0.40 mg/kg. kg, 0.60 mg/kg, 1.00mg/kg.
